Super Flower Leadex III Gold 1000W Fully Modular PSU
ATX 3.1 & PCIe 5.1 Future-Proofing: Designed to meet the absolute latest Intel ATX 3.1 specifications, the Leadex III 1000W safely mitigates the massive transient power spikes commonly generated by modern flagship graphics cards. Furthermore, Super Flower has completely engineered around the infamous 12VHPWR cable bending issue. Instead of using a fragile 16-pin connector on the power supply itself, this unit features robust dual 8-pin sockets that merge into a native 12+4 pin connector on the GPU side, delivering extremely clean, high-wattage power without the risk of terminal melting.
Premium Efficiency and Build Quality: While it easily clears the 80 PLUS Gold standard, independent testing by Cybenetics has awarded this unit a prestigious Platinum efficiency rating, ensuring minimal energy waste and reduced heat output. Internally, the Leadex III relies on a top-tier Japanese main capacitor known for exceptional reliability, heat tolerance, and delivering tight voltage regulation with extremely low ripple noise.
Intelligent, Silent Cooling: To keep the internals frosty, Super Flower equipped the Leadex III with a premium 140mm Fluid Dynamic Bearing (FDB) fan built with a copper shaft for long-lasting durability. Thanks to the built-in ECO thermal control system, the fan remains completely stationary during light to medium workloads, providing a perfectly silent 0dB experience. When you launch a heavy game or rendering task, the fan intelligently spins up to maintain optimal temperatures. All of this power is routed through ultra-flexible, flat ribbon cables, making neat cable management effortless.

Specifications of Super Flower Leadex III Gold 1000W Fully Modular PSU
| Feature | Specification |
| Model | Leadex III Gold 1000W (SF-1000F14GE) |
| Form Factor | ATX (150mm x 150mm x 86mm) |
| Max Power Output | 1000 Watts |
| Efficiency Rating | 80 PLUS Gold / Cybenetics Platinum |
| ATX Standard | ATX 12V v3.1 / EPS 12V v2.92 |
| Modularity | 100% Fully Modular |
| Fan Size / Type | 140mm Fluid Dynamic Bearing (FDB) |
| Protections | OVP, OCP, OPP, SCP, UVP, OTP, NLO, SIP |
| PCIe 16-Pin (12V-2×6) | 1x Included (Dual 8-pin to 12+4 pin design) |
| PCIe 6+2 Pin | 4x Cables included |
| CPU 8 (4+4) Pin | 2x Cables included |
| SATA / Molex | 8x SATA / 4x Molex |

Frequently Asked Questions
- Will this 1000W power supply fit in my mid-tower case? Yes. Measuring just 150mm in length, the Leadex III 1000W is surprisingly compact for its massive wattage. It will easily fit into standard ATX mid-tower cases without requiring you to remove hard drive cages or struggle with cable routing in the basement of your case.
- Why are there dual 8-pin connections on the power supply for the new 16-pin GPU cable? Super Flower intentionally designed it this way for safety. The new 12V-2×6 (16-pin) socket is prone to overheating if the cable is bent too sharply near the connector. By using two standard, highly durable 8-pin sockets on the power supply itself and merging them into the 16-pin connector at the GPU end, it eliminates the risk of the cable melting at the power supply housing while still fully complying with ATX 3.1 standards.
- Does it come with cables for older graphics cards? Yes. While it includes the new 16-pin cable for modern RTX 40-series and 50-series cards, it also comes with four standard 6+2 pin PCIe cables, ensuring full compatibility with older NVIDIA and AMD graphics cards.
